Pet Doctors Veterinary Clinic (Ryde)
23 Spencer Rd, Ryde, United KingdomDirections
Write down the GPS coordinates we've got on our file for this veterinarian, so you can enter them into your GPS to assist you locate the veterinary physician easily.:
GPS
50.730007, -1.167025-
Location
United Kingdom, England, Ryde -
Address
23 Spencer Rd, Ryde, United Kingdom
Call them before dropping by
This will be the most recent make contact with details we've:
-
Telephone +44 1983 562878
-
E-mail
not provided -
Website
www.petdoctors.co.uk/clinic/ryde
If you believe that any on the info is incorrect, please get in touch with us. Assistance us be better day-by-day.

We strongly recommend contacting this veterinary hospital before dropping by, since it could be closed, moved or changed its opening hours.